Yujun Song is a professor in School of Mathematics and Physics at USTB in Beijing, China, focusing in surface and interface controlled fabrication of nanohybrid thin films and their applications in magneto-optical effects and biosensing using template-assisted physical vapour deposition process or self-assemble of nanomaterials. Having obtained his Ph. D degrees in Materials Science and Engineering from Beijing University of Chemical Technology, he spent 5 years working for Louisiana State University in nano and microfabrication and their application in bio-nanotechnology, 2 years working for Old Dominion University in localized surface plasmon resonance of noble metal arrayed thin films and their application as single nanoparticle biosensors, 7 years working for Beihang University in template-assisted growth process of nanostructural thin films and microfluidic synthesis of nanoparticles. He also spent one year working at University of Toronto as a visiting professor in semiconductor nanowires, before taking up his present appointment at USTB. Professor Song has authored over 70 scientific publications (including one book editor, authors for 8 book chapters, 2 review articles) and issued 21 invention patents.
